Transaction df60adbda7df998cd0643dff4acfb8650cf938bef06e3d1bd2e26d20a40f8e72

1 Input
1 Outputs
  • df60adbda7df998cd0643dff4acfb8650cf938bef06e3d1bd2e26d20a40f8e72:0
  • value  844680
    address  1PfWaGQfy89etDdEfwMncBP1pfEn75yumn